Data-Driven Policing: Innovations and Insights
This chapter examines the integration of evidence-based practices with traditional policing methods in a large police force. It discusses various innovative approaches, including randomized controlled trials and communication strategies to enhance crime prevention, such as using deterrents and motivational messaging. The chapter highlights the significance of merging seasoned officers' knowledge with data to effectively combat crime and reduce recidivism.
